Keep it clean for better and safer performance.   Inspect the Patio Set periodically, and if damaged, have it repaired by an authorized   technician.   10. Stay alert. Watch what you are doing, use common sense. Do not assemble the   Patio Set when you are tired.   11. Check for damaged parts. Before using the Patio Set, any part that appears   damaged should be carefully checked to determine that it will operate properly and   perform its intended function. Check for alignment and binding of moving parts; any   broken parts or mounting fixtures; and any other condition that may affect proper   operation. Any part that is damaged should be properly repaired or replaced by a   qualified technician.   12. Replacement parts and accessories. When servicing, use only identical   replacement parts. Use of any other parts will void the warranty.   13. Do not assemble the Patio Set if under the influence of alcohol or drugs. Read   warning labels if taking prescription medicine to determine if your judgement or   reflexes are impaired while taking drugs. If there is any doubt, do not assemble the   Patio Set.   14. Choose the proper location. Set up the Patio Set on a flat, dry, level surface.   15. Be aware of weather conditions. Make sure the umbrella is tied in the closed   position or removed entirely during windy weather. The wind can knock over the   umbrella and table causing serious injury.   16. Maintenance. Assembling the Table Stand (#1): Use two sets of Screws (#6) on each side of the   Brace (#10) to support the bottom of the Table Stand (#1). Align the Umbrella Stand (#9)   next to the Brace (#10). See FIGURE 1.   FIGURE 1   Table   Stand (#1)   Brace (#10)   Screws (#6)   Umbrella   Stand (#9)   2. Attach the two Brackets (#11) to the   underside of the Table Board (#2) using   four sets of Table Screws (#5).   See FIGURE 2.   FIGURE 2   Screws (#6)   Table   Board   (#2)   Bracket (#11)   Table Screw (#5)   FIGURE 3   3. Attach the Table Stand (#1) to   the Brackets (#11) on the   Table Board (#2) using two sets   of Screws (#6).   See FIGURES 2 & 3.   Screws (#6)   Page 4   SKU 09018   Download from Www.Somanuals.com. All Manuals Search And Download.   Assembly (continued)   4. Connect the Umbrella (#8) and the   FIGURE 4   Umbrella (#8)   Pole (#12) using Screw (#7). Slide the   Pole (#12) into the Umbrella Stand (#9).   See FIGURE 4.   Screw (#7)   Pole (#12)   Umbrella Stand (#9)   5. Attach the Chair Board (#4)   to the Chair Stand (#3)   using four sets of   FIGURE 5   Screws (#6).   Chair   Board   (#4)   Note: Remember to set   the Patio Set up on a   flat, dry, level surface. Do   not deploy the Umbrella (#8)   during windy conditions.   Chair Stand (#3)   Maintenance   1. Periodically check the hardware and tighten if necessary.   2. If you leave the set outdoors during inclement weather, it is recommended that you seal   the set with a marine quality varnish or paint.   Page 5   SKU 09018   Download from Www.Somanuals.com.
